How to fill out the MN AASP Loaner Car Agreement online

Filling out the MN AASP Loaner Car Agreement online is a straightforward process. This guide provides step-by-step instructions to help you complete the agreement accurately and efficiently.

Follow the steps to complete the loaner car agreement.

  1. Press the ‘Get Form’ button to obtain the Loaner Car Agreement and open it for editing.
  2. Enter the date of the agreement in the designated field, formatted as '___ day of ________, 2007'. Ensure you follow the format to prevent any confusion.
  3. In the first blank space, fill in the name of the service garage providing the loaner vehicle.
  4. In the second blank space, input your name as the customer requesting the loaner vehicle.
  5. Initial each section as prompted to acknowledge your understanding of the terms outlined in the agreement.
  6. Fill out the section confirming you hold a valid driver's license in Minnesota and that you’ll be the primary operator of the vehicle. Make sure to also confirm that no driver under age 25 will use the vehicle.
  7. Complete the insurance section by entering the necessary insurance coverage amounts as required. Ensure these amounts meet or exceed the specified minimums.
  8. Initial the insurance section to agree to the terms regarding liability and claims against your insurance.
  9. Review the dispute resolution clause and initial to confirm your understanding and acceptance.
  10. Provide the vehicle details, including the date borrowed, mileage out, gas level, and any visible damage noted at the time of borrowing.
  11. Sign and date the agreement at the bottom to finalize your acceptance of the terms.
  12. After completing all sections, save the changes to the document and consider downloading, printing, or sharing the form as needed.

A car dealership is not legally obligated to provide a loaner car unless specified in warranty terms or policies. However, many dealerships offer them for customer convenience and satisfaction. If you are interested in loaner options, ask the dealership directly about their policy. Reviewing the MN AASP Loaner Car Agreement can clarify available services.

Dealerships typically keep loaner cars in their fleet for about one to three years, depending on their policy and the vehicle's condition. The MN AASP Loaner Car Agreement ensures that these cars are well-maintained and regularly updated. After a certain mileage or age, the dealership may sell the car, and replace it with a newer model. This helps maintain a high standard for loaner vehicles that customers can rely on.

The GM warranty does not provide for a loaner vehicle, however most dealers will offer a loaner or rental (free of charge) under certain circumstances. You have to get the details from the dealer, it's best to go thru your salesperson or a manager if you need a loaner.

A loaner car is a car that many dealerships, mechanics, and body shops offer as a convenience when you bring in your car to get serviced or have maintenance performed on your vehicle. ... Some small businesses may offer to drive you home or to your business and pick you up when your car is ready.
